300 VR vs 200-400 for distant subject

A question to those who have experience with both lenses.
According to what I've read (Thom Hogan:

, Michael Weber:

) the 200-400 is a very good lens at near/middle distance. It's not equally good when shooting distant subjects, and therefore it does not seem suitable for landscape/cityscape photography. I wonder if the 300/2.8 VR has a different character and would greatly appreciate knowing how it performs when shooting near and distant subjects.
I use D300 & D700.
